  • Patent number: 8999501
    Abstract: A urethane foam member that after cutting into the desired shape from sheet urethane foam is applied with adhesive on one face of the urethane foam, an edge portion of the non-adhesive applied face at least at one side of the urethane foam member being of a low edge profile, to which permanent thermal distortion has been induced such that the thickness of the edge portion of the side is thinnest at the end portion thereof and the thickness gradually increases with distance from the end portion.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: November 25, 2008
    Date of Patent: April 7, 2015
    Assignees: Ricoh Company, Ltd, Bridgestone Corporation
    Inventors: Takaya Muraishi, Satoshi Hatori, Kaoru Yoshino, Norio Yamagami, Etsuo Kakizaki
